In 2005, the Head of the Herd (Craig Jones) noticed that his mother was using a white paste, intended for use on cows, to help with her Psoriasis. The cream was formulated to help keep the skin on cow’s udders in good condition

for milking. Cow’s udders need to be kept soft and supple, not dry and cracked. No one likes an angry cow with sore or cracked udders when it comes time to attach those milking cups. Although it seemed to be working well, the cream was thick and hard to apply. Since his mum didn’t particularly like being lathered in a thick cream made for cows, he took on the task of reformulating it and made up a lighter, non-greasy version. The word “udder” was a bit crass for an old-fashioned “lady” so they referred to it as “MooGoo” (goo for the cows) and the name stuck. Starting a skin care company wasn’t the initial idea, but friends and family kept asking for more of it, and eventually, Craig went into business. Since then MooGoo has grown to over 40 products to help with lots of different skin and scalp problems and sold throughout the world. From dealing with irritable skin and itchy scalps to natural sun care products and a baby range for the little ones. And most recently, a natural dental range. MooGoo’s ingredient philosophy has always remained the same: To make effective products using healthy ingredients, that we are comfortable using on ourselves and our loved ones. Craig continues to be very involved in the business, focusing mostly on formulation and product development.

Here’s some uplifting news!

We help sponsor the training costs of nurses wanting to further their qualifications in cancer care because we truly believe we need more of them. We currently sponsor two scholarship categories: one for initial training and another for more specialised cancer care roles.

It is impossible to choose! Each applicant submits both a written essay and a video presentation, and every one we’ve seen highlights just how passionate, intelligent, and compassionate these nurses are. Many share deeply personal experiences caring for someone with cancer, which inspired them to pursue this path.

Reading their stories reminds us that we must have some of the best future cancer care nurses in the world. Their dedication, empathy, and commitment to helping others is genuinely inspiring.

It really is difficult to choose just 1 winner and runner-up in each category because they all deserve support. We’ll be selecting the recipients shortly, but if this is the sort of thing anyone else would like to contribute towards, please let us know. There are at least 10 candidates we would love to help, but sadly we have to narrow it down to 4.

Our Pink Eczema Cream (AUSTL457188) was working so well for people that we recently decided to make a Pink Shampoo and Conditioner for dandruff and itchy scalps. It’s quickly become one of our most popular products.

The pink colour comes from Vitamin B12. There are quite a number of studies showing this ingredient can be very helpful for eczema, although they often get overlooked (there’s a lot of information out there). Since adding it, we’ve seen fantastic results for people with skin and scalp concerns.

Coincidentally, there are other pink shampoos on the market, which was a surprise to us. Maybe we don't get out much. For us, the pink colour was originally a concern - we thought people (especially men) might not go for it. So it was even more surprising to see that some shampoos use an artificial pink colourant called Erythrosine. Worth looking into before putting it on your skin.

There are generally two approaches to treating scalp problems. One is the “sledgehammer” approach - using harsh detergents or sometimes acids to strip away flakes. Despite claims of being gentle, the ingredients can be quite strong. An example of the ingredients used are below, and when you stop using them, your scalp can end up drier than before.

Our approach is different. No sledgehammer. We use a mix of 4 gentle cleansers as a little of each tends to be milder, along with ingredients that help support the scalp’s microbiome. The goal is to improve scalp health over time, not just provide a quick fix.

Natural ingredients are usually more expensive than synthetic ones, so we’re a little surprised our shampoo and conditioner is a lot less expensive than the one below.
